Tips

To further enhance the child’s learning experience, consider encouraging them to create a timeline of key events involving women in history, marking significant achievements and their impact on society. Additionally, they might enjoy a comparison project where they explore the similarities and differences between women from various cultures or time periods. Engaging in discussions or debates about the relevance of these women's contributions today will also deepen their understanding and appreciation of history and social studies.
